在TIOBE编程语言排行榜中,Java一直位列前三,现在有7到1000万的Java开发者。许多应用程序的所有代码都是用Java编写的,这意味着集成开发环境(IDE)很重要,因为它是开发人员编写、测试和运行Java程序的必备工具。今天给大家分享5款最受Java开发者欢迎的开源IDE:1.BlueJBlueJ为Java初学者提供了一个集成的Java开发环境,专为教学而设计,同时也提供了使用Java的帮助。开发工具包(JDK)开发小型软件。在笔记本电脑上安装好BlueJIDE后,开始一个新的项目,只需在项目菜单中点击新建项目,就可以开始编写Java代码了,代码示例如下:BlueJ不仅提供了一个交互式的图形用户界面(GUI),用于在学校教授Java编程课程,也允许开发人员在不编译源代码的情况下调用函数(对象、方法、参数)。下载地址:https://www.bluej.org/versions.html2.EclipseEclipse是最著名的JavaIDE之一,它还支持多种编程语言,如C/C++、JavaScript和PHP。它还允许添加扩展以方便开发,Eclipse还为DevOps团队提供了一个名为EclipseChe的Web集成开发环境。下载地址:https://www.eclipse.org/ide/3、IntelliJIDEAIntelliJIDEACE(CommunityEdition)是IntelliJIDEA的一个开源版本,它为Java、Groovy等多种编程语言提供了一个IDE,Kotlin、Rust、Scala等,IntelliJIDEACE也很受开发者欢迎,开发者可以用它来重构现有的源代码、代码检查、用JUnit或TestNG构建测试用例、用Maven或Ant构建代码。IntelliJIDEACE有一些独特的功能,我特别喜欢API测试器,例如,如果您使用Java框架实现RESTAPI,IntelliJIDEACE允许您通过SwingGUI设计器测试API的功能:IntelliJIDEACE是开源的,但也有商业版。下载地址:https://www.jetbrains.com/idea/4、NetbeansIDENetBeans是一个开源的软件开发集成环境,一个开放的框架,一个可扩展的开发平台,可以在Java、C/C++、PHP和otherlanguagesDevelopment,本身就是一个开发平台,可以通过扩展插件来扩展功能。NetbeansIDE支持多种平台,例如Windows、MacOS和Linux。在本地环境安装IDE工具后,新建项目向导会帮你创建一个新项目。官方地址:https://netbeans.org/5、VSCodiumVSCodium是一个轻量级、免费的各种操作系统平台的源代码编辑器,它是一个基于VisualStudiocode的开源替代品,它还有支持多种编程语言的丰富生态系统。例如,Java、C++、C#、PHP、Go和Python。对于高质量的代码,VisualStudioCode默认提供调试、智能代码补全、语法高亮和代码重构。VSCodium是VSCode的一个分支。其外观和功能与VSCode完全相同。从上图不难看出。官网地址:https://vscodium.com/Java是使用最广泛的编程语言和环境之一首先,这五种只是Java开发者可用的各种开源IDE工具中的一小部分。很难说哪一个是最好的。这主要取决于您的需求。希望你能找到适合自己的JavaIDE。
